Merkow’s croaks
Seafood-steakhouse on Greenville Ave. never attracted much business to begin with.
DALLAS Nancy Nichols at D magazine's FrontBurner pronounces Merkow's, a sortof seafood-sortof steakhouse place that it seemed like hardly anyone ever went to, dead.
